Anyone made one? Want to build something to hold 2-3 deer over night. Was thinking some sort of small shack with window-unit AC in it. Just want to get cold enough to where in Oct, Nov. Feb. when it's hot we don't have to quarter deer that we shoot in afternoon hunts.

you can easily build one. Problem will be the window unit freezing up.

They do make an aftermarket piece to by pass that and allow it to chill down lower. Not sure if it helps the freezing up issue though. Just google for the by pass switch and something should pop up.

Window unit plus CoolBot will get it down to the low 40s

I've got a Cool-Bot on a refrigerated trailer. 14,000 BTU window unit. We haul meat all over the country for BBQ cooks with it. Set it up right, and it does a good job of keeping the unit from freezing.
